Useless Vodacom
After over a month of back and forth emails and phone calls to numerous departments of Vodacom, I have had enough.
Vodacom Northgate made the mistake of not capturing details correctly and not documenting my insurance. I handed in my phone for repairs at Vodacom Cresta at the end of August. It keeps getting sent to the advanced repair shop in Pretoria and back again to Cresta not fixed. Why? Because Vodacom is utterly useless and has zero customer service. Every time I have to phone the repair call centre and explain to the 7 million different people who answer that it is not my fault that Northgate stuffed up with the documentation, I get told I must speak to Northgate. Northgate tells me to speak to the Insurance department. They refer me back to Northgate who refer me to the call centre who tell me to speak to Insurance who replies with I need to speak to Cresta as they must send in the claim form and so on and so on. This is beyond unacceptable. Every month I am billed for a device that is not in my possession as it is with YOU Vodacom. Therefore you are charging me for something that is not being provided. That is a breach of contract. This is ********** and basically theft.
I am so sick and tired of being told that I need to speak to someone else all the time. Your employees made the mistake - why the hell must I struggle this much to sort it out?
It also doesn't help that when you contact the Advanced repair centre they never answer the phone. Do not know how they are so busy that they cannot answer the phone as I know damn well they are definitely NOT busy FIXING MY PHONE.
I want this sorted out immediately or I will take this matter to ICASA and the Consumer Ombudsmen.
I struggle to understand how you could possibly be this bad at providing basic services if one considers how long you have been operating.
Do you just not care? You will happily take my money each month but do not deliver on what was agreed on in the contract. I do not see the need to pay every month when I am not getting what I am paying for.
I want my phone fixed or if that is too difficult a task (which it seems to be) then just give me a new phone.
And maybe train your employees better on how to capture data, follow proper procedures and how not to put the phone down in someones ear when a customer has called.
